chiark / gitweb /
src/: Carve out a `representation' subfield of adns_rrtype.
[adns.git] / changelog
index 7eea428447d5173142fc18f2bcd9dd4ebc371c21..642d69b950d1ba9e49da4c22eef1cbb58dc805ab 100644 (file)
--- a/changelog
+++ b/changelog
@@ -1,3 +1,14 @@
+adns (1.4); urgency=low
+
+  Improvements for multithreaded programs:
+  * New documentation comment in adns.h explaining thread guarantees
+    (or lack of them), replaces `single-threaded' note at the top.
+  * Fix string conversion of adns_r_addr not to use a static buffer
+    (function csp_addr) so as to make thread promise true.
+  * Make an internal variable const-correct (expectdomain in pa_ptr).
+
+ -- Ian Jackson <ian@davenant.greenend.org.uk>  Tue, 17 Oct 2006 17:05:08 +0100
+
 adns (1.3); urgency=low
 
   Portability fixes:
@@ -10,8 +21,11 @@ adns (1.3); urgency=low
     (Patch from Mihai Ibanescu.)
   * Remove spurious `_' from {bin,lib,include}dir Makefile variables.
     (Report from Mihai Ibanescu.)
+  * Do away with `mismatch' variable in parse.c:adns__findrr_anychk so that
+    overzealous GCC cannot complain about members of eo_fls being
+    uninitialised.  (Report from Jim Meyering.)
 
- --
+ -- Ian Jackson <ian@davenant.greenend.org.uk>  Tue,  6 Jun 2006 20:22:30 +0100
 
 adns (1.2); urgency=medium